Safer Operations with TeAM Monitoring Solution in Geothermal Areas

The Kamojang Geothermal Area, operated by PT Pertamina Geothermal Energy (PGE), is a vital hub for Indonesia’s renewable energy. However, the terrain presents significant geohazard risks, with volcanic soil and steep slopes reaching up to 45 degrees. Following landslide events in the early 2020s and minor slope failures recorded in 2025, protecting high-pressure geothermal pipelines and infrastructure has become the highest priority for operational continuity.

Integrated Solutions by PT Telematika Aset Monitoring (TeAM)

To mitigate these risks, PT Telematika Aset Monitoring (TeAM) implemented a comprehensive Geohazard Monitoring System across 14 strategic locations within the Kamojang field. Despite the challenging field conditions—including remote access and the need for complex cable routing of up to 130 meters—the project was executed with precision and a high commitment to safety.

Real-time Geotechnical Monitoring using Rotary Wire Extensometer, Tiltmeter, Data Logger, and dashboard remote monitoring using Trimble 4D Control Server

Advanced Technology Stack:

  • 12 Units of Geo-XW 100 Rotary Wire Extensometers: Specifically used to track deep-seated ground displacement with high accuracy.

  • 2 Units of Tiltmeters: Deployed to measure slope inclination and detect the slightest angular movements that indicate instability.

  • Starlink Satellite Connectivity: Ensures that critical data is transmitted in real-time without interruption, even in the most remote areas.

  • Trimble 4D Control (T4D) Dashboard: Provides a centralized platform for real-time visualization, automated alerts, and deep-dive analytics.

Project Impact and Safety Excellence

By providing real-time insights into ground stability, this system empowers PGE Kamojang to make data-driven decisions and respond proactively to potential threats. TeAM’s commitment to quality and safety was further validated by an exceptional HSSE evaluation score of 93.59 out of 100.

As we move through 2026, this monitoring infrastructure stands as a benchmark for safety in the geothermal industry, ensuring that green energy production remains uninterrupted and personnel stay protected.
